Ryzen 5 5600U vs Core i5-10500H specs and performance
According to the hardwareDB Benchmark tool, the Core i5-10500H is faster than the Ryzen 5 5600U.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Ryzen 5 5600U in all gaming tests too.
Info from our database shows that they both have the same core count and the same number of threads. Our comparison shows that the Core i5-10500H has a slightly higher clock speed compared to the Ryzen 5 5600U. Also, the Core i5-10500H has a slightly higher turbo speed. A Ryzen 5 5600U CPU outputs less heat than a Core i5-10500H CPU because of its signific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ption.
Modern CPUs generally have more logical cores than physical cores, this means that each core is split into multiple virtual cores, improving efficiency for parallel workloads. Indeed, the Ryzen 5 5600U has more threads than cores. Each physical core is split into multiple threads.
